dc.description.abstractPrediction of coverage is very important in order to increase QoS and determine blind spot in communication systems. Obstructions in the scenarios can block the rays emanating from the transmitter and reaching on the receiver. UTD model can be used to determine whether threshold electric field on the receiver is provided or not. In this study, double diffraction coefficient and spreading factors are derivated and it is used in electric field strength calculation. In addition, some comparisons are made by FEKO electromagnetic solver software.en_US
